There is no direct connection from Nice to Monte Isola. However, you can take the train to Ventimiglia, take the train to Genova P.Za Principe, take the train to Brescia, take the train to Sulzano, walk to Sulzano, then take the line 26 ferry to Carzano.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Nice to Carzano via Milano, Autostazione Lampugnano, Brescia - Autostazione, Sale Marasino - Stazione FNM Via Roma, and Sale Marasino in around 9h 58m.
